Junjou Romantica is a popular Yaoi anime and manga series that follows the romantic relationships between three different couples. The series has gained a dedicated following for its unique and emotional story-lines, as well as its slightly okay representation of the LGBTQA+ community. At one point it was the only Yaoi series out there that actually showed relationships and had a plot. Even though it’s an iconic series, it’s important to note that the series also has its fair share of issues and problematic elements. It is not easy to crack an adaptation of a beloved video game to the public when you are appeasing fans and those who aren’t familiar with the source material. Somehow, The Last of Us manages to pull off just that thanks to the partnership of showrunner Craig Mazin and game creator Neil Druckmann. These two had the daunting task of adapting the world and characters of the game as well as expanding on the original story. We had the chance to chat with the team behind Neopets! Tell us about Match 3 games and Faerie’s Hope? We were looking for a way to introduce Neopia to a new group of fans (and reconnect with those that have not had an opportunity to connect with the brand in a while) and settled on the Match3 Genre as a good way to introduce character(s), game play and most importantly the stories and lore that help to make Neopets what it is.  Match 3 games like Faeries Hope, allow users to engage with the brand and it’s lore as much or as little as they want.
